A user of Google’s Opinion Rewards has been asked questions pertaining to a ‘tasty food with the letter N,’ according to a report by Android Police. Google Opinion Rewards is a programme that provides users with Play Store credits for answering consumer surveys.
During his visit to India last year, Pichai had said that the next version of Android may be selected by an online poll. This was in response to a student’s query over naming a version of the mobile OS after an Indian dessert. Pichai had also said at the time, “And if all Indians vote, I think we can make (an Indian name) it happen."
